A jazz minor scale is a minor scale with a raised sixth and seventh degree a melodic minor when moving upwards. This scale can be abstracted from the characteristic movement of minor key melodies where the raised seventh acts as a leading note in the ascending direction the sixth is raised to avoid an augmented interval between the sixth and seventh degrees. A melodic minor scale for the melodic minor scale, you raise the sixth and seventh notes of the natural minor scale by a half step as you go up the scale and then return to the natural minor as you go down the scale.
